Central Park Escape
Central Park’s 843 acres represent 6% of the total surface of the island. It features a variety of terrains and vistas, ranging from the beautifully sculptured balustrades of Bethesda Terrace to the woodsy solitude of the Ramble. It offers each New Yorker, however much jaundiced and jaded, escape from the clamorous confines of the urban environment and insight into ourselves, not to mention the glimpse of the occasional raccoon. Central Park allows us to breath, to stretch, to discover possibilities and see around corners and into the great curved horizon that is so often hidden.

Ballet Record Set In Central Park
Dancers from the American Ballet Theater and the Kips Bay Boys and Girls Club attempted to set the Guinness World Record for “Most Ballerinas En Point.” The record try was made in New York’s Central Park. (Aug. 3)
